What Are Windows 11 Widgets?
Widgets in Windows 11 Pro are compact, dynamic tiles that live in the widget panel—a personalized dashboard that sits on the left side of your screen. Accessible via the taskbar or by swiping in from the left edge, the widget board consolidates useful, glanceable data for quick reference.
These widgets can display:
- Microsoft To Do tasks
- Outlook calendar events
- News updates
- File recommendations
- Weather and productivity tips

Setting Up Windows 11 Widgets for Task Tracking
Step 1: Access the Widgets Panel
Click the widget icon on your taskbar (looks like a square divided into quarters) or press Windows + W to launch the panel.
Step 2: Sign In with Your Microsoft Account
To sync Office data, you must use the same Microsoft account connected to your Microsoft Office 2024 and OneDrive.
Step 3: Add Essential Widgets
Click on the “+” button or “Add widgets.” Prioritize:
- Microsoft To Do – For task management and reminders
- Outlook Calendar – For meetings and deadline tracking
- Recommended Documents – Smart file suggestions from OneDrive and Office apps
- Tips – To explore new features or productivity hacks
Monitoring Deadlines in Office 2024 Using Widgets
Microsoft To Do Widget
To Do syncs with tasks from:
- Outlook emails (flagged messages)
- Teams task assignments
- Planner and Project integrations
- Manual task entries
Key Features:
- Drag tasks to reorder priorities
- Mark items as complete from the widget itself
- See task due dates and recurring reminders
- Color-code categories for work, personal, urgent, etc.
Outlook Calendar Widget
Stay aware of meetings, project reviews, or submission deadlines by:
- Viewing today’s and tomorrow’s events
- Tapping a meeting to open it in Outlook or Teams
- Getting reminders via banner notifications
Recommended Documents Widget
This widget uses Microsoft Graph and AI to suggest:
- Files you’ve recently worked on
- Shared docs needing attention
- Relevant Office 2024 documents connected to calendar events

Integration with Office 2024 Apps
Word & Excel:
Use the Recommended Documents widget to reopen files you’ve been actively working on.
Outlook:
Flagged emails create To Do tasks, which appear in your widgets instantly.
Teams:
Tasks assigned in Teams Planner sync with To Do, which feeds into your widget dashboard.
Troubleshooting Widget Issues
Widgets Not Updating?
- Restart Windows Explorer from Task Manager
- Re-sign into your Microsoft account
- Check for system updates and widget support services
To Do or Outlook Data Not Syncing?
- Ensure OneDrive is connected and syncing
- Confirm Microsoft 365 subscription status
- Reinstall the problematic app or clear widget cache
